Market permits

A family walking through Southbank to the craft markets.Approval from Brisbane City Council is required to operate markets, including farmer and craft markets. The level of approval required is dependant on a number of factors such as the:

  • location, land ownership or tender conditions
  • type of markets or goods being sold
  • frequency of the markets
